    Core Innovation: Stepwise Melting Technology for Unmatched Adaptability


    The cornerstone of the JY Series' superiority is its patented Stepwise Melting Technology. Unlike conventional single-point melting materials that can create weak points and cracks during thermal cycling, the JY powders are designed to melt across a gradient. This technology enables the formation of a continuous, protective ceramic-like film over a broad temperature range from 300°C to 1100°C. As temperature rises, different components within the powder melt sequentially, seamlessly filling voids left by decomposing organic binders and creating a dense, coherent barrier that adapts to thermal expansion and contraction


    . This effectively solves critical industrial pain points like cold-hot cycle cracking and protection gaps in wide-temperature domains.

    Precision-Tuned Portfolio for Every Thermal Challenge


    The JY Series offers a meticulously graded portfolio, allowing engineers to select the optimal product for specific temperature thresholds and performance requirements:

    JY230 (Starts melting at ~350°C): The frontline defender against thermal shock and cracking. It initiates protection at lower temperatures, ideal for applications like commercial stove burners that face direct flame and rapid water cooling cycles.

    JY270 (Starts melting at ~700°C): The versatile performer for anti-oxidation and enhanced adhesion. Its melting point suits environments around 600-800°C, such as motorcycle engine parts and exhaust systems, where it improves metal wettability and forms a mechanical interlocking grid to resist vibration-induced peeling.

    JY290 (Starts melting at ~900°C): The high-temperature specialist for resisting thermal shock and acid/alkali corrosion at temperatures up to 1000°C.

    JY1100 (<1100°C): The ultimate shield for extreme heat, such as boiler linings, where it begins melting around 750°C to isolate oxygen and drastically reduce the oxidation rate of the substrate.

    Beyond Heat Resistance: Integrated Performance & Economic Benefits


    The advantages of JY Series powders extend far beyond temperature tolerance, delivering a multi-functional performance package:


    Superior Corrosion Resistance: The powders form a borosilicate glass network at high temperatures that captures free ions, creating stable silicates. This grants exceptional salt fog resistance exceeding 3000 hours (UL certified), tripling the anti-corrosion lifespan compared to many conventional products.


    Enhanced Coating Economy: With a controlled oil absorption value of ≤19g/100g—approximately 25% lower than market averages—the JY Series significantly reduces resin consumption in coating formulations without compromising performance, leading to direct cost savings.


    Excellent Compatibility & Stability: The entire series maintains a neutral pH of 7.0±0.5, ensuring superb compatibility and stability with various resin systems, preventing premature curing or degradation.


    Global Environmental Compliance: Formulated with a lead-free recipe, the JY Series is certified for REACH and ROHS standards, eliminating export barriers and supporting sustainable manufacturing initiatives worldwide.
